Think of the 13-ft length of the ladder as the hypotenuse of a right triangle. Represent the horiz. distance from foot of ladder to base of tree by x, or 5 ft.
Represent the vert. dist. from base of tree to top of ladder by y, which is unknown.
Then (13 ft)^2 = (5 ft)^2 + y^2, or
169 ft^2 = 25 ft^2 + y^2. This simplifies to y^2 = 144. Thus y = + 12 feeet.
